"Faith Risks" Bill Berger, Pastor Luke 19:26
 In Luke 19, Jesus told the story of the importance of risk taking. He said if you don't take risks, you don't have faith. If you don't have any faith you're being unfaithful. I love the way He concludes the story. Luke 19:26: "Risk your life and get more than you ever dreamed of; play it safe and you end up holding the bag." You're looking at a living example of that verse... "Risk your life and get more than you ever dreamed of." It is important in our faith journey to take risks of faith. As we mature, we start to understand God's voice and his leading. In light of the Anderson's faith risk to join the All Saints journey and the journey of their next step, we are going to learn about how important it is to understand that risks bring us to maturity and a wild ride with Jesus. I want to take us all on the journey of All Saints and how the risks brought us to where we are at today and where they will take us tomorrow.
